Appreciating quality cinema
Staff Reporter
CHENNAI:
Communication Students of Madras Christian College are to run an interactive Public Campaign on "Quality Cinema" as an initiative to change the attitude of youth towards movies.
The college proposes to hold a series of events starting with a Film Appreciation Workshop, on Saturday, between 9.30 a.m. to 6.00 p.m. on the college premises. The resource person for the workshop is Louis Mathew, Program Officer, Kerala State Chalachitra Academy. The campaign calls for an inter-college Paper Presentation Competition on the topic "In 21st century, cinema form takes precedence over content" on September 12.
A Workshop on Cinematography is also scheduled. To cater to the students in the city, the students of Madras Christian College are organising a film screening followed by interactive sessions with experts from the Film Industry at the Film Chamber Of Commerce, Nungambakkam.
